IELTS Writing Correction
- 1. Clarify the comparison Original: similar to ancient times, even today Suggested revision: as in ancient times, sports events today Why it matters: The revised comparison states the time relationship clearly and supplies a subject for the clause.
- 2. Correct the word choice Original: extenuate the global riots Suggested revision: alleviate global violence Why it matters: ‘Extenuate’ means to make an offence seem less serious and does not mean reduce violence.
- 3. Remove the article Original: maintaining the harmony Suggested revision: maintaining harmony Why it matters: ‘Harmony’ is an uncountable abstract noun here and does not take ‘the’.
- 4. Remove the comma Original: I believe, it is true Suggested revision: I believe it is true Why it matters: No comma should separate the reporting verb from its content clause.
- 5. Clarify the reference Original: it must flourish Suggested revision: these events should flourish Why it matters: The plural noun phrase clearly identifies sports events as the intended reference.
- 6. Use the standard term Original: worldwide game events Suggested revision: international sporting events Why it matters: ‘International sporting events’ is the natural term for competitions involving many nations.
- 7. Use concise wording Original: towards the preparation of the event Suggested revision: towards preparing for the event Why it matters: The gerund construction is more direct and natural.
- 8. Correct the noun phrase Original: the global show off of supremacy Suggested revision: global displays of supremacy Why it matters: ‘Show off’ is a phrasal verb and does not function naturally as the noun used here.
- 9. Correct the event reference Original: recent world cup event whereby Suggested revision: recent World Cup, during which Why it matters: The proper name needs capitals, and ‘during which’ correctly refers to a time period.
- 10. Match the singular evidence Original: on account of these statistics Suggested revision: based on this statistic Why it matters: Only one numerical claim is given, so the reference should be singular.
- 11. Use a natural collocation Original: propitious Suggested revision: beneficial Why it matters: ‘Beneficial to’ expresses the intended positive effect more naturally.
- 12. Use a clearer link Original: due to sport Suggested revision: through sport Why it matters: ‘Through sport’ more clearly expresses the means by which nations interact.

Why this response received Band 6.0
The response maintains a clear opinion and offers several relevant mechanisms by which sport might reduce conflict, showing ambition in both ideas and vocabulary. Its main limitation is loss of precision: unsupported statistics, loosely connected claims, and inaccurate wording sometimes distort the argument, most seriously when the conclusion says sport stamps out harmony; the priority is to use credible, fully explained evidence and simpler accurate language.
IELTS Writing Criteria Scores
Task Response
The position is clear and relevant reasons are presented, but several claims rely on unsupported or implausible examples and the conclusion contains a contradictory phrase.
Develop one or two credible mechanisms in depth and ensure the conclusion restates the intended claim accurately.
Coherence and Cohesion
The essay progresses from position to supporting reasons with clear paragraphing, though the long third paragraph accumulates loosely connected claims.
Divide or streamline the third paragraph and make each example explicitly support one controlling idea.
Lexical Resource
There is a broad and ambitious vocabulary range, but frequent inaccurate choices and collocations often make the meaning unnatural or imprecise.
Prefer accurate common expressions over forced items such as extenuate, agglomeration, and stamping out harmony.
Grammatical Range and Accuracy
Complex structures are attempted, but recurring article, agreement, plural, and sentence-construction errors reduce accuracy.
Edit systematically for articles and subject-verb agreement, then simplify sentences whose clause structure becomes unstable.
